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A control device for an electronic aerosol provision system is configured to receive a replaceable component to form an electronic aerosol provision system. The control device is further configured to receive an identifier from a replaceable component received by the control device; and to modify one or more characteristics (such as resistance to draw, RTD) of an air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system dependent upon the received identifier.

The invention claimed is: 1. A control device for an electronic aerosol provision system, the control device being configured to receive a replaceable component to form an electronic aerosol provision system, the control device being configured to: receive an identifier from the replaceable component received by the control device; and modify one or more characteristics of an air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system dependent upon the received identifier; wherein the one or more characteristics of the air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system comprise resistance to draw. 2. The control device of claim 1 , wherein the control device is configured to modify the resistance to draw of the air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system dependent upon the received identifier to provide a substantially consistent resistance to draw for the electronic aerosol provision system for different received replaceable components. 3. The control device of claim 1 , wherein the output provides information about a consumable material in the replaceable component from which the identifier was received. 4. The control device of claim 1 , wherein the control device further includes a communication interface for interacting with a remote server either directly or indirectly via a smartphone. 5. An electronic aerosol provision system comprising the control device of claim 1 . 6. The control device of claim 1 , wherein the control device is configured to modify the resistance to draw by modifying a cross-sectional area of the airflow path in at least one location. 7. The control device of claim 6 , wherein the control device is configured to modify the resistance to draw at an inlet or an outlet of the airflow path. 8. The control device of claim 1 , wherein an airflow modifier is provided to modify at least one of a cross-sectional area or a length of the airflow path. 9. The control device of claim 8 , wherein the airflow modifier comprises a diaphragm that can be widened or narrowed to modify the cross-sectional area of the airflow path. 10. The control device of claim 8 , wherein the airflow modifier is either: located in the control device; or located in the replaceable component. 11. The control device of claim 8 , wherein the airflow modifier is electrically operated to modify at least one of the cross-sectional area or the length of the airflow path. 12. The control device of claim 11 , wherein the electrical operation of the airflow modifier includes generating a magnetic field to modify the cross-sectional area of the airflow path. 13. The control device of claim 11 , wherein the electrical operation of the airflow modifier utilizes thermal expansion to modify the cross-sectional area of the airflow path. 14. A control device for an electronic aerosol provision system, the control device being configured to receive a replaceable component to form an electronic aerosol provision system, the control device being configured to: receive an identifier from the replaceable component received by the control device; and provide output to a user based on the received identifier, wherein the output is provided on a display of the electronic aerosol provision system, and wherein in response to identifying the replaceable component, the display is configured to collect user input comprising control information for use with the replaceable component. 15. The control device of claim 14 , wherein the control device is configured to transmit the output for display on an external system. 16. The control device of claim 14 , wherein the output is dependent upon an authorization of the received identifier. 17. The control device of claim 14 , wherein the output provides information about a consumable material in the replaceable component from which the identifier was received. 18. A method of operating a control device for an electronic aerosol provision system, the method comprising: receiving a replaceable component to form an electronic aerosol provision system; receiving an identifier from the replaceable component; and in response to the received identifier: modifying one or more airflow characteristics of an air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system dependent upon the received identifier, wherein modifying one or more airflow characteristics of the airflow path through the electronic aerosol provision system comprises modifying a resistance to draw of the airflow path. 19. A method of operating a control device for an electronic aerosol provision system, the method comprising: receiving a replaceable component to form an electronic aerosol provision system; receiving an identifier from the replaceable component; and in response to the received identifier: providing output to a user based on the received identifier using a display of the electronic aerosol provision system, wherein in response to identifying the replaceable component, the display is configured to collect user input comprising control information for use with the replaceable component.
